Chronic Illnesses
Long-term health conditions that are persistent and usually require ongoing management, such as diabetes or heart disease.
Morbidity
The condition of being diseased or the incidence rate of disease in a population.
Health
The state of complete physical, mental, and social well-being, not merely the absence of disease or infirmity.
Wellness
An active process of becoming aware of and making choices toward a healthy and fulfilling life; it encompasses physical, mental, and social well-being.
